Prove that the coefficient of (r + 1)th term in the expansion of (1 + x)n + 1 is equal to the sum of the coefficients of rth and (r + 1)th terms in the expansion of (1 + x)n.

Answer:

Given,

Coefficients of (r + 1)th term in (1 + x)n+1n+1Cr

Sum of the coefficients of the rth and (r + 1)th terms in (1 + x)n ,

(1 + x)n = nCr-1 + nCr

n+1Cr [since, nCr+1 + nCr = n+1Cr+1]

Thus, proved.
